BlackBerry KEY2 autoloader serves as a vital tool for power users and IT administrators looking to perform a clean OS installation or recover a device from a "bricked" state. Unlike standard Over-the-Air (OTA) updates, autoloaders are executable files that wipe the device and flash the official BlackBerry-signed Android firmware directly from a computer. An autoloader is a self-contained flashing file containing the complete official Android operating system framework built by BlackBerry. Unlike standard custom ROM recovery packages found elsewhere in the Android community, a BlackBerry autoloader is uniquely packaged to automatically communicate directly with the device's internal bootrom.
